Our Mission
Heroes Resource Center is a non-profit community-based organization that is dedicated to providing resources and services to Veterans, Service Members, and their families in a safe, family-friendly environment.
Through this model of peer-to-peer interaction, Heroes Resource Center is able to quickly address the unique situations that service members, veterans, and military families experience by creating a trusting relationship more immediately.
Heroes Resource Center offers a number of services and activities including peer-to-peer groups and activities, individual/family rehabilitative activities, a Counselor from the Vet Center, a Veteran Service Officer (claims/benefits), a VA Loan Specialist, Financial Assistance and representatives from the Texas Workforce Commission.
Heroes Resource Center hosts multiple weekly activities like our Donuts & Coffee twice a week, and our Veterans Support Group. Through these gatherings, many veterans and service members find a new “family”, a job, and an answer to some of their problems.
We offer many social events including the monthly Friday Peer Dinners & A Show, the annual Just Because Christmas Party, Turkey & Fixings Basket, as well as our highly attended Heroes Appreciation BBQ. All these events are offered at “no-cost” or obligation for active military, veterans, first responders, and their families.
Beyond the services, events, and resources Heroes Resource Center provides, our big mission is outreach and fostering relationships with family, friends, and the integration from military to civilian life. We model ourselves around the idea of a supportive community and by healing all those affected by transition through positive encouragement, support, and open doors.




The Founders: Wes & Judy Pierce
Wes and Judy Pierce founded Heroes Night Out after they saw firsthand the challenges Veterans face when returning home. What began as a simple effort, handing out appreciation wallets with gift cards to wounded soldiers, has grown into a full-service Veterans Resource Center.
In 2025, the organization rebranded as Heroes Resource Center, reflecting its expanded mission to provide Veterans and their families with vital resources, peer connection, and community all in one place.
